(Jan. 5, 1931 - Jan. 6, 2014)
OraGay Myrick, of Powell, 83, died on Monday, Jan. 6, 2014, in Billings, after a brief illness.
She was born on Jan. 5, 1931, in Rock Springs, to Raymond and Margaret (Gale) Davis.
OraGay was raised in Green River, where she attended schools and graduated from high school. She then attended the University of Wyoming where she achieved an English degree in education and became a Tri Delt. This is where she became reacquainted with Richard Myrick who had enrolled at the university after being discharged from the Army. She met Richard in Byron while growing up.
They dated and were later married in Denver on Sept. 9, 1952. They were married for 58 years until Richard passed away in 2011.
They lived in San Jose, Calif., Cheyenne, Powell and Nampa, Idaho, later returning to Powell. They raised four children, were blessed with nine grandchildren and 12 great-grandchildren.
OraGay was a very devoted, loving, and active wife, mother, grandmother, and great-grandmother. She enjoyed time with her family and was an active participant in all of her family’s sports and activities. She was a homemaker but periodically substitute taught at the Powell schools. She managed the Sport Shack in Powell and also worked at Marquis Awards before retiring.
OraGay was a member of the Union Presbyterian Church and had a passion for playing in the bell choir for many years. She also played the piano and organ for occasions and for her family. She was in the League of Women Voters for a number of years.
OraGay was also an excellent knitter and her family was given many beautiful afghans, sweaters, scarves, and hats. She enjoyed traveling and saw much of the United States, Alaska, Canada, and Europe. OraGay played and enjoyed bridge club with many friends over the years. She was generous with her time and donated time to the senior citizens, the library and the Buffalo Bill Historical Center.
